Andre Cisco was the most happy player to join the New York Jets this offseason.
Cisco inked a one-year deal worth $10 million in New York.
Cisco, 24, appeared in 16 games with 14 starts for the Jacksonville Jaguars last year, recording seven passes defended and an interception along with 68 tackles including one for loss.

More than any other reason, Cisco is happy to become a Jet because he grew up a fan of the team as a New York City native. He even had photos of him enjoying a Jets game as a kid posted to social media in the past.
